“I don’t accept that it will not be taxed as income and is placed on the W2 just for information purposes”

There IS going to be a tax on high-cost health plans starting in 2018, but that tax will be levied on insurance companies, not individuals. http://www.healthcare.gov/center/authorities/section1401_highcostplan.pdf

Of course, like all the other taxes imposed by Obamacare (on insurance companies, medical device companies, pharmaceutical companies), these taxes all ultimately will be passed onto consumers.
